This comprehensive book, 'Armed Non-State Actors in International Humanitarian and Human Rights Law: Foundation and Framework of Obligations, and Rules on Accountability' by Konstantinos Mastorodimos, delves into the critical legal aspects surrounding non-state actors in conflict. It meticulously examines the foundation and framework of their obligations under international humanitarian and human rights law, while also exploring the crucial rules on accountability. A must-read for legal scholars, practitioners, and policymakers interested in the evolving landscape of international law. The book provides an in-depth analysis of legal frameworks, obligation structures, and accountability mechanisms related to armed non-state actors. It covers foundational principles and practical applications within international humanitarian and human rights law.
